As a Senior Technical Program Manager (TPM), you will lead the coordination, execution, and successful delivery of one or more complex end-to-end product and engineering projects. You will be responsible for ensuring that all projects are optimized for readiness, execution, utilization, and velocity while driving seamless collaboration across engineering, product, and cross-functional teams. This role requires a blend of technical expertise, strategic execution, and leadership skills to manage multiple domain partners, influence technical decisions, and guide teams through the full software development lifecycle. The ideal candidate will be adept at breaking down complex projects, managing ambiguity, and fostering collaboration across engineering, product, and leadership teams to drive innovation, quality and efficiency.
What You Will Accomplish
Drive end-to-end execution of complex technical programs from concept to launch, ensuring alignment with business goals.
Collaborate with engineering and product teams to design features, prioritize tasks, and maintain roadmaps with clear milestones and dependencies
Lead technical discussions to facilitate scalable architecture decisions and guide Agile methodologies for optimizing delivery processes
Monitor program execution, identifying blockers and implementing mitigation strategies to ensure smooth progression
Serve as the primary point of contact for stakeholders, providing program status updates and resolving escalations
Partner across functions to align execution strategies and drive consensus in decision-making processes
Drive discussions on technical feasibility and best practices, supporting design discussions and architecture reviews
Establish governance frameworks to uphold quality, transparency, and accountability throughout program lifecycles
Implement automation and tooling to enhance program tracking, transparency, and operational oversight
What You Will Bring
10+ years of experience working directly with product & engineering teams on software development projects.
8+ years of experience in technical program or product management, leading large-scale, cross-functional initiatives.
Experience managing technical roadmaps, defining product requirements, and driving system architecture decisions.
Experience in crafting epics & user stories, release planning, backlogs, and agile methodologies.
Proven ability to influence stakeholders, build consensus, and navigate ambiguity.
Strong understanding of scalability, reliability, and system design trade-offs.
Excellent problem-solving, communication, and leadership skills.
Strong knowledge of project tracking tools (Airtable, JIRA, Confluence, etc.).
Ability to drive continuous process improvements and automation.
